1: Invest in an Energy Audit:

One of the best ways to reduce energy loss is to invest in an energy audit. This will allow you to identify areas where your system is losing energy, such as leaky ductwork or inefficient insulation. From there, you can make improvements that will help reduce energy consumption and save money long-term.

2: Install a Programmable Thermostat:

Installing a programmable thermostat can help reduce energy costs by automatically adjusting the temperature in your building during periods when it is not being used. For example, if no one is in the office after 5 PM, you can set the thermostat to turn down the temperature so it doesn’t work overtime when no one is there to enjoy it.

3: Upgrade Your HVAC System:

If you have an older HVAC system, chances are it’s not as efficient as modern models on the market today. The good news is that newer models come with features like variable speed compressors and variable speed fan motors that allow them to adjust their output depending on changing conditions inside and outside of your building – meaning they don’t have to work as hard (and use more energy) than older models do.  Plus, upgrading your system could potentially qualify you for tax credits or other incentives available from local utilities!

4: Check Your Air Filters Regularly:

Clogged air filters can cause your HVAC system to work harder than necessary – leading to higher utility bills each month! To avoid this problem, be sure to check your filters regularly and replace them when needed. This simple step can go a long way toward reducing energy loss from your HVAC system!

5: Seal Ductwork Leaks:

Did you know that up to 30% of the conditioned air can be lost through leaky ductwork? Sealing any cracks or gaps in the ductwork will prevent conditioned air from escaping before it reaches its intended destination – resulting in improved efficiency and reduced energy costs over time!

6: Maintain Your System Yearly:

Scheduling regular maintenance for your HVAC system every year is essential for ensuring optimal performance throughout its lifespan – as well as reducing repair bills down the line

7: Change Outdated Equipment:

Older equipment may lack features like variable speed fans or compressors that would make them more efficient than newer models on the market today – so if yours is outdated, now might be a good time to look into replacing it with something more up-to-date! You may even qualify for a rebate or tax credit from local utilities if you choose ENERGY STAR® certified products – so don’t forget about checking those out too!

8: Insulate Your Building:

Poor insulation can lead to wasted energy due to heat transfer between interior spaces and outside temperatures – but luckily this issue is easy enough to address with proper insulation materials! Look into adding insulation around windows, doors, walls, attic spaces, basements, etc. since these are all areas where heat could potentially escape if left unchecked. This simple step will result in improved efficiency (and lower bills!) over time.
